  • Amazingly Simple breathing technique to try right Now.

    Breathing to relax

    Have you ever found yourself feeling stressed or anxious and you are literally gasping for air , struggling to breathe?

    This is scary, right?

    Probably you have found the more you try to breathe the harder it becomes,true?

    Well now you can use this amazingly simple breathing technique that will instantly relax you, letting both your mind and body settle .

    The best thing is , as it is so simple, all you have to do is remember 3 numbers : 4-7-8

    Simple right?

    So this is what you do:

    1- Breathe in through your nose to the count of 4

    2- Hold that breathe to the count of 7

    3- Breathe out through your mouth to the count of 8

    When you breathe in just focus on your breath breathing in calmness, love and relaxation.

    When holding your breath just visualise this calmness, love and relaxation flowing through your mind and body.

    Finally when breathing out imagine you are blowing out through a straw all the while releasing any tension, fears and worries.

    Notice and feel how you begin to relax and calm down just by using this simple conscious breathing technique.

    This will allow you to begin to breathe normally again.

  • The Stroop Effect Myth or Reality?

    The Stroop Test

    Just been helping my daughter with her science project with one of my all time favourite psychological experiments. The Stroop Test.

    Although used for assessing attention deficiencies and brain injury disorders it can also help people become more aware of how we process information and how we can improve our attention span and focused attention.

  • Now you come to mention it Yes I am stressed and anxious.

    Anxiety Stressed

    Stress and anxiety are in my experience involved in a great many of the causes for clients coming for hypnotherapy.

    People looking for hypnotherapy may present with an issue such as smoking or weight loss however I see stress and anxiety as an underlying cause and can lead to many problems if ignored.

    Relaxation exercises, and other stress management techniques can be very useful in overcoming stress and anxiety caused by everyday life. So much so I utilise these frequently.

    Due to a variety of socio-economic conditions, stress and anxiety have now become more widely recognised by both individuals and employers. Globally thousands of work days are lost to these conditions .

    In addition there is great personal anxiety which can lead to relationship tension , depression, panic attacks and many other problems.

    Effective stress and anxiety management means not just dealing with the presenting stress and anxiety but to also help to avoid reaching high stress and anxiety levels in the first place. Hypnosis can help by:


    >Creating an understanding about the reasons and factors underlying stress and anxiety.

    > Teaching relaxation techniques so you can develop new ways to relax naturally and easily.


    >Reframing thinking to help with panic attacks, anxiety and fears.

  • World Obesity Day

    World Obesity Day

    Key facts (according to WHO World Health Organisation)

    • Worldwide obesity has nearly tripled since 1975.
    • In 2016, more than 1.9 billion adults, 18 years and older, were overweight. Of these over 650 million were obese.
    • 39% of adults aged 18 years and over were overweight in 2016, and 13% were obese.
    • Most of the world’s population live in countries where overweight and obesity kills more people than underweight.
    • 38 million children under the age of 5 were overweight or obese in 2019.
    • Over 340 million children and adolescents aged 5-19 were overweight or obese in 2016.
    • Obesity is preventable.
